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05

¿Te gustaría conocer todo sobre el HC-05? En este artículo encontrarás las especificaciones, la hoja de datos y la forma de conexión del HC-05 con Arduino. ¡No te lo pierdas!

El módulo Bluetooth HC-05 es un convertidor de Bluetooth a serie que conecta microcontroladores (como Arduino) a otros dispositivos habilitados para Bluetooth. El pinout y las especificaciones del HC-05 se dan b

Pinout HC-05 con descripción:

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05
NÚMERO DE PIN Nombre del pin Descripción de pines
1. CLAVE/Es Este pin se utiliza para poner el módulo Bluetooth en modo de comandos AT. Por defecto, este pin opera en modo de datos. El pin Key/EN debe estar alto para operar Bluetooth en modo de comando. En HC-05, la velocidad en baudios predeterminada en modo comando es 38400 bps y 9600 en modo datos.
2. CCV Se utiliza para alimentar el módulo Bluetooth. Dale 5V / 3.3V a este Pin.
3. TIERRA El pin de tierra del módulo.
4. TXD Conecte este pin con el pin RXD del microcontrolador. Este pin transmite datos en serie (las señales inalámbricas recibidas por el módulo Bluetooth se convierten por módulo y se transmiten en serie en este pin)
5. RXD Conecte este pin al pin TXD del microcontrolador. El módulo Bluetooth HC-05 recibe los datos de este pin y luego los transmite de forma inalámbrica.
6. ESTADO Se utiliza para comprobar si el módulo está conectado o no. Actúa como un indicador de estado.
HC-05 Descripción

HC-05 Especificaciones

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05
HC-05 Especificaciones

**Fuente de imagen: electrosoma

  • Protocolo Bluetooth: Especificación Bluetooth v2.0+EDR (Velocidad de datos mejorada)
  • Frecuencia: Banda ISM de 2,4 GHz
  • Modulación: GFSK (Modificación por desplazamiento de frecuencia gaussiana)
  • Potencia de emisión: ≤4dBm, Clase 2
  • Sensibilidad: ≤-84dBm a 0,1% BER
  • Velocidad: Comunicación asíncrona: 2,1 Mbps (máx.) / 160 kbpsComunicación síncrona: 1Mbps/1Mbps
  • Seguridad: autenticación y encriptación
  • Perfiles: puerto serie Bluetooth
  • Voltaje de suministro: +3,3 V a 6,0 V
  • Corriente de suministro: 30mA
  • Temperatura de trabajo: -20 ~ +75 centígrados
  • Dimensión: 26,9 mm x 13 mm x 2,2 mm
  • El módulo Bluetooth HC-05 sigue el protocolo estandarizado IEEE 802.15.1, a través del cual se puede construir una red de área personal (PAN) inalámbrica. Utiliza tecnología de radio de espectro ensanchado por salto de frecuencia (FHSS) para enviar datos por aire.

Hoja de datos del módulo Bluetooth HC-05:

Descargue la hoja de datos completa desde este enlace: Hoja de datos HC-05

Introducción al módulo Bluetooth HC-05

El HC-05 es un convertidor de Bluetooth a serie muy fácil de usar. HC-05 conecta microcontroladores (como Arduino) a otros dispositivos habilitados para Bluetooth. Esto permite que los dispositivos se comuniquen de forma inalámbrica entre sí.

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05
Módulo Bluetooth HC-05

HC-05 es un Bluetooth SPP (Protocolo de puerto serie) módulo diseñado para la comunicación inalámbrica. También se puede operar como una configuración maestra o esclava.

Funcionamiento del módulo Bluetooth HC-05:

El módulo Bluetooth HC-05 se puede utilizar en dos modos de funcionamiento: modo de comando y modo de datos.

Modo de comando:

En Modo Comando, podemos comunicarnos con el módulo Bluetooth a través de Comandos AT para configurar varios ajustes y parámetros del Módulo. Esto incluye la información del firmware, cambiar la tasa de baudios, cambiar el nombre del módulo, etc. También podemos usarlo para configurar el HC-05 como maestro o esclavo. Para seleccionar cualquiera de los modos, debemos activar el modo de comando y enviar los comandos AT correctos. La tasa de baudios es 38400bps en modo comando.

Modo de datos:

En este modo, el módulo se usa para comunicarse con otros dispositivos Bluetooth, es decir, la transferencia de datos ocurre en este modo. Intercambio de datos entre dispositivos. La tasa de baudios es de 9600 bps en modo de datos.

Distribución de pines de la placa de conexiones HC-05:

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05
Configuración de pines de la placa de conexiones HC-05
Nombre PIN Alfiler Tipo Descripción
TIERRA 13,21,22 VSS Olla molida
3.3 CCV 12 3,3 V Suministro integrado de 3,3 V con salida de regulador lineal en chip dentro de 3,15-3,3 V
AIO0 9 bidireccional Línea de entrada/salida programable
AIO1 10 bidireccional Línea de entrada/salida programable
AIO0 23 RX bidireccional ES Línea de entrada/salida programable, salida de control para LNA
AIO1 24 TX bidireccional EN Línea de entrada/salida programable, salida de control para megafonía
PIO2 25 bidireccional Línea de entrada/salida programable
PIO3 26 bidireccional Línea de entrada/salida programable
PIO4 27 bidireccional Línea de entrada/salida programable
PIO5 28 bidireccional Línea de entrada/salida programable
PIO6 29 bidireccional Línea de entrada/salida programable
PIO7 30 bidireccional Línea de entrada/salida programable
PIN08 31 bidireccional Línea de entrada/salida programable
PIO9 32 bidireccional Línea de entrada/salida programable
PIO10 33 bidireccional Línea de entrada/salida programable
PIO11 34 bidireccional Línea de entrada/salida programable
REINICIAR 11 Entrada CMOS con pull-up interno débil Restablecimiento de bajo. La entrada rebotada debe ser baja durante >5 MS para provocar un reinicio
UART_RTS 4 Salida CMOS, triestable con pull-up interno débil Solicitud UART para enviar, activo bajo
UART_CTS 3 Entrada CMOS con pull-down interno débil UART claro para enviar, activo bajo
UART_RX 2 Entrada CMOS con pull-down interno débil Entrada de datos UART
UART_TX 1 Salida CMOS, triestable con pull-up interno débil Salida de datos UART
SPI_MOSI 17 Entrada CMOS con pull-down interno débil La entrada de datos de la interfaz periférica en serie
SPI_CSB dieciséis Entrada CMOS con pull-up interno débil Selección de chip para la interfaz de periféricos en serie, activo bajo
SPI_CLK 19 Entrada CMOS con pull-down interno débil El reloj de la interfaz de periféricos en serie
SPI_MISO 18 Entrada CMOS con pull-down interno débil La salida de datos de la interfaz periférica en serie
USB_- 15 bidireccional
USB_+ 20 bidireccional
CAROLINA DEL NORTE 14
PCM_CLK 5 bidireccional El reloj de datos PCM síncrono
PCM_SALIDA 6 Salida CMOS La salida de datos PCM síncrona
PCM_IN 7 Entrada CMOS La entrada de datos PCM síncrona
PCM_SYNC 8 bidireccional La luz estroboscópica de datos PCM síncrona

Conexiones Arduino HC-05:

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05
Conexión HC-05 con Arduino

  • Conecte un LED a una placa Arduino con la ayuda de cables de puente.
  • Conecte el módulo Bluetooth (HC-05) al Arduino con la ayuda de cables de puente. Excepto el primero y el último pin, todos los demás pines deben estar conectados al Arduino.
  • Tierra de HC-05 a Tierra de Arduino.
  • Potencia de HC-05 a 3.3V de Arduino.
  • Tx de HC-05 a Rx de Arduino.
  • Rx de HC-05 a Tx de Arduino.

** Tutorial completo aquí: Arduino LED controlado a distancia usando HC-05

Aplicaciones del módulo Bluetooth HC-05:

  • Dispositivos informáticos y periféricos
  • receptor GPS
  • controles industriales
  • proyectos de UCM

Error 403 The request cannot be completed because you have exceeded your quota. : quotaExceeded




Preguntas frecuentes sobre el p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05

Pinout HC-05, especificaciones, hoja de datos y conexión Arduino HC05

El módulo HC-05 es un módulo de comunicación Bluetooth popular que se utiliza comúnmente en proyectos de electrónica y robótica. Aquí encontrará las respuestas a las preguntas más frecuentes sobre el pinout, especificaciones, hoja de datos y conexión del HC-05 con Arduino.

1. ¿Cuál es el pinout del HC-05?

El HC-05 tiene 6 pines en total. Estos son:

  1. VCC: Pin de alimentación (3.3V – 6V).
  2. GND: Pin de tierra.
  3. TXD: Pin de transmisión.
  4. RXD: Pin de recepción.
  5. EN: Pin de habilitación.
  6. STATE: Pin de estado.

2. ¿Cuáles son las especificaciones del HC-05?

Las especificaciones del HC-05 incluyen:

  • Tipo de módulo: Clase 2, perfil Bluetooth v2.0+EDR.
  • Distancia de transmisión: Hasta 10 metros.
  • Frecuencia: 2.4 GHz banda ISM.
  • Velocidad de transmisión: 2.1 Mbps.
  • Potencia de transmisión: -6 dBm a 4 dBm.

3. ¿Dónde puedo encontrar la hoja de datos del HC-05?

La hoja de datos del HC-05 se puede encontrar en el siguiente enlace: es.wikipedia.org/Hoja_de_datos_HC-05

4. ¿Cómo puedo conectar el HC-05 con Arduino?

Para conectar el HC-05 con Arduino, debe seguir los siguientes pasos:

  1. Conecte el pin VCC del HC-05 al pin 5V de Arduino.
  2. Conecte el pin GND del HC-05 al pin GND de Arduino.
  3. Conecte el pin TXD del HC-05 al pin RX de Arduino.
  4. Conecte el pin RXD del HC-05 al pin TX de Arduino.
  5. Conecte el pin EN del HC-05 al pin 3.3V de Arduino.
  6. Asegúrese de que los pines RX y TX estén cruzados entre el HC-05 y Arduino.

Esperamos que estas preguntas frecuentes le hayan proporcionado la información necesaria sobre el pinout, especificaciones, hoja de datos y conexión del HC-05 con Arduino. Si desea obtener más detalles, le recomendamos visitar el enlace a la hoja de datos proporcionado anteriormente.


Deja un comentario